Each month will feature a different musician or small chamber group as soloist or featured ensemble. \n$10 at the door | $7 on Eventbrite in advance | $5 at the door with student ID \n\n  \n \nAbout the musicians:\nBarrie Cooper is Acting Concertmaster of the Memphis Symphony. She started violin studies at four with John Kendall at the Suzuki program of Southern Illinois University\, Edwardsville. She also served as Kendall’s assistant\, traveling across the US and Japan to workshops and conferences. Barrie studied viola (because none of her friends would) in order to join the Più Mosso Quartet\, which gave numerous concerts in the Midwest and East Coast. For two years\, she was Principal Viola in the St. Louis Symphony Youth Orchestra. After attending Ithaca College\, Barrie graduated from Peabody Conservatory\, where she won the Marbury Violin Competition and the Josef Kasper Prize for excellence in violin performance. Barrie has spent the last 14 summers as Principal Second Violin at the American Institute of Musical Studies orchestra in Graz\, Austria. A die-hard St. Louis Cardinals fan\, she shares her home with two beautiful dogs and five wonderful cats. \n \nIn addition to private piano instruction at Rhodes College\, Brian Ray is the departmental collaborative pianist and also teaches piano classes at the University of Memphis. He has been a soloist with the University of Memphis Orchestra and the Memphis Civic Orchestra and has performed extensively as an assisting pianist in voice recitals. His most recent collaborative ventures have included art song recitals of works by Richard Hundley\, Samuel Barber\, Libby Larsen\, and Rebecca Clarke. He has been a student of Allison Nelson and Joan Gilbert. His areas of research include the piano works of Joseph Marx\, piano repertoire of the 20th century\, works for piano ensemble\, and harpsichord.

Wiggins\, and Sheree Renée Thomas. \n\n\nAbout Nicole Mitchell:\nNicole M. Mitchell is an award-winning creative flutist\, composer\, bandleader\, and educator. She is perhaps best known for her work as a flutist\, having developed a unique improvisational language and having been repeatedly awarded “Top Flutist of the Year” by Downbeat Magazine Critics Poll and the Jazz Journalists Association (2010-2017). Mitchell initially emerged from Chicago’s innovative music scene in the late 90s\, and her music celebrates contemporary African American culture.  \nShe is the founder of Black Earth Ensemble\, Black Earth Strings\, Sonic Projections\, and Ice Crystal\, and she composes for contemporary ensembles of varied instrumentation and size\, while incorporating improvisation and a wide aesthetic expression. The former first woman president of Chicago’s Association for the Advancement of Creative Musicians\, Mitchell celebrates endless possibility by “creating visionary worlds through music that bridge the familiar with the unknown.” Some of her newest work with Black Earth Ensemble explores intercultural collaborations; Bamako*Chicago\, featuring Malian kora master\, Ballake Sissoko\, made its American debut at Chicago’s Hyde Park Jazz Festival in September 2017\, and Mandorla Awakening with Kojiro Umezaki (shakuhachi) and Tatsu Aoki (taiko\, bass\, shamisen)\, was just recently released on FPE records (Chicago) last spring.  \nAs a composer\, Mitchell has been commissioned by the French Ministry of Culture\, the Chicago Museum of Contemporary Art\, Art Institute of Chicago\, the Stone\, the French American Jazz Exchange\, Chamber Music America (New Works)\, the Chicago Jazz Festival\, ICE\, and the Chicago Sinfonietta. Mitchell has performed with creative music luminaries including Craig Taborn\, Roscoe Mitchell\, Joelle Leandre\, Anthony Braxton\, Geri Allen\, George Lewis\, Mark Dresser\, Steve Coleman\, Anthony Davis\, Myra Melford\, Bill Dixon\, Muhal Richard Abrams\, Ed Wilkerson\, Rob Mazurek\, and Billy Childs\, and Hamid Drake. She is a recipient of the Herb Alpert Award (2011)\, the Chicago 3Arts Award (2011) and the Doris Duke Artist Award (2012).   \nMitchell is a Professor of Music at University of California\, Irvine\, teaching composition and improvisation in the graduate program of Integrated Composition\, Improvisation and Technology.   \nLearn more at https://www.nicolemitchell.com/

DESCRIPTION:Enjoy good vibes with Jiana Hunter and The Jam Session this holiday weekend in the Crosstown Arts Green Room. \nVocalist Jiana Hunter and The Jam Session are a collective unit of musicians and band leaders whose styles range from Classic Rock\, Jazz\, Soul\, and Hip Hop to Gospel and Reggae. \nTickets: $10 (purchase on Eventbrite) \n\nAbout Jiana Hunter:\nOriginally from Cincinnati\, Jiana moved from Motown to Memphis\, continuing her career as a songwriter\, singer\, praise and worship leader\, and music educator. She intentionally shares good vibes of inspiration and encouragement throughout any musical set as is displayed in her solo release\, True Love. \nJiana’s diverse experience has allowed her to perform with artists Steve Lee\, Prime Cut Band\, Bamboo Forest\, Bobby McFerrin\, Eric Roberson\, Donald Lawrence\, KEM\, Anthony Hamilton\, Marvin Winans\, among others. \nJiana has performed in various sponsored events by Memphis Music Commission\, Dizzy Bird Jazz Lounge\, Jazz at Lincoln Center\, Carnegie Hall and national corporations. Earlier this year at Crosstown Arts\, Jiana Hunter debuted her sold out Ella Fitzgerald tribute concert\, sponsored by Strictly Jazz Entertainment. \nUsing her artistry to build a philanthropic endeavor\, Jiana Hunter Music/JiJizJam provides classical and commercial music voice training to youth and adults. As an 18-year music education veteran\, Jiana has taught at Visible Music School\, Oakland University\, Arts League of Michigan\, Middle Tennessee State University (workshop presenter)\, Stax Music Academy\, Cincinnati and Shelby County Schools\, School for Creative and Performing Arts\, Marvin L. Winans Academy of Performing Arts. as well as St. Georges Independent Schools.

DESCRIPTION:Join musician/writer Alex Greene for a listening session featuring the sounds of Memphis. \nUsing an app called Loopy HD\, Alex goes through different groups of sounds\, slowly adding and subtracting noises recorded right on the streets of Memphis. You might hear simple sounds\, like feet walking through leaves\, the roar of an overhead jet\, or a leaf blower. You might hear more suggestive sounds\, like music from an amphitheater\, gun shots\, or tornado sirens. They’re all geared to get people thinking about what surrounds them every day\, and — most importantly — what they like or dislike hearing. Participants are given cards they’ll use to rate each sound as positive\, negative\, or neutral. \nIn addition\, Greene will play some of the creative mash-ups that local musicians and producers have contributed\, using field recordings from the Memphis streets. It will be the first public airing of works slated to be collected in a dedicated Memphis 3.0 album.
